    Five regions, five distinct school systems

    San Francisco, the Peninsula, South Bay, East Bay, and Marin each boast their own distinct academic cultures and enrollment criteria. Because where you live dictates where your child can thrive, we help you connect these geographical pieces early in the process.

    Housing and school choices are deeply intertwined

    In the competitive Bay Area landscape, finding a home and choosing a school must happen simultaneously. The realities of the local real estate market and commuting corridors will shape your education boundaries. We partner with you to balance both priorities seamlessly.

    How assignment works here is worth understanding early. San Francisco Unified runs a citywide choice system, where an attendance area gives your child a tiebreaker rather than a reserved place, while districts on the Peninsula, in the South Bay and in Marin generally assign by residence. That single difference is why housing and school decisions are best made together, and it is usually where our consultants start.

      Does living near a school mean our child will be assigned there?

      In San Francisco, not on its own. San Francisco Unified runs a citywide choice system: families rank schools in order of preference, and living in an attendance area gives a child a tiebreaker at that school rather than a reserved place. Children living on the same street can be assigned to different schools.

      Districts on the Peninsula, in the South Bay and in Marin generally assign by residence instead, which is one reason this region rewards deciding where to live and where to apply at the same time. We help families work through both together.

      San Francisco, the Peninsula, the South Bay, the East Bay and Marin each run on their own admissions logic and their own calendars, and the commute between them shapes what is realistic as much as the map does. A family weighing Palo Alto against Marin is weighing two different school searches rather than two addresses.

      Earlier than most families expect. The San Francisco Unified main round closes at the start of February for the following school year, and most independent schools across the Bay Area close their applications in December, which puts the decisions that matter in the fall.
